Full Job Description
P-1016

In this role, you will lead all aspects of data security for the Databricks Lakehouse platform. You will drive the product strategy to identify, prioritize and deliver both the external and internal controls necessary for customers to meet their privacy, confidentiality, digital sovereignty and other regulatory obligations. You will create elegant yet simple policy models that enable customers to control access to their most important assets. Your work will help IT and security administrators feel at ease with increasing Databricks usage in their organization. Our data champions will benefit from the data security and operational simplicity you provide, to ensure that they can focus their time on creating most value for their users. You will report to a Senior Director of Product management.

The impact you will have:
  • Make security a market differentiator that enables Databricks to succeed in enterprise and regulated industries.
  • Help Databricks gain the trust of CSO teams of security sensitive customers and qualify the Lakehouse platform for all data classes in the customer organization.
  • Build a vision for a best-in-class network and data security policy model that provides secure access to customer workloads and data while minimizing exposure to unauthorized access and risk of data loss.
  • Partner with privacy, legal, and security teams to deliver anonymization, retention, and residency for regulated data and sensitive assets such as AI models.
  • Deepen our understanding of evolving threats and corresponding technologies in data security. Use customer inputs to serve as an expert and propose new innovations or best practices from the industry.
  • Partner with cloud providers and support confidential compute
  • Rationalize and refine the differences in customer experience and data security technologies across multiple clouds including Azure, AWS and Google Cloud.

What we look for:
  • 7+ years of product management experience with enterprise B2B or SaaS products, with experience delivering successful customer-facing products/features.
  • Domain expertise in data security, data privacy, and encryption
  • An accomplished senior product manager who can define and deliver on success metrics, summarize customer inputs into actionable requirements, and crisply communicate product value propositions to customers and sales teams.
  • Experience partnering with senior engineering leadership with an ability to deep-dive into complex technical concepts.
  • Experience driving business results through influential leadership across multiple partner teams including engineering, sales, marketing, solution architects and customer success.
  • Passion for designing products that simplify user experience of technically complex products.

About Databricks

Databricks is a unified analytics platform that provides data engineering, collaborative data science, and machine learning capabilities. The company was founded in 2013 by the original creators of Apache Spark, a popular open-source big data processing engine. Databricks provides a cloud-based platform that allows data teams to collaborate and build data pipelines, run machine learning models, and perform advanced analytics. The company has raised over $1 billion in funding and is valued at $38 billion as of November 2021.
